  • Fetch a public pricing page and extract first-pass pricing signals before you quote plan costs, free tiers, or plan names. Use this when you already have a likely pricing URL and need a quick live scan of visible page text. It returns price-like strings, heuristic plan labels, free or free-trial signals, and cache information. It does not map prices to exact plans, normalize currencies, execute checkout flows, or guarantee that a price applies to a specific region or customer type. JavaScript-rendered, logged-in, or heavily obfuscated pricing details can be missed. Results are cached for 5 minutes.

  • Drill into a specific URL after search surfaces it. Returns the extracted text content plus metadata. Internal routing: PDFs hit Anthropic Files API for OCR + structured extraction; HTML pages are fetched + text-extracted via readability-style stripping. Use for: verifying a verbatim quote from a Reddit thread, reading a primary source in full (earnings transcript, research paper), drilling into a vendor product page after search surfaced the URL. NOT for: discovering new URLs — use search/search_community/search_research first. This tool takes a known URL only. Optional max_chars 100-50000, default 8000. SSRF-protected: private IPs + localhost blocked.

  • Download a PDF from a URL and extract all text content, page by page. Use this to read the full text of a specific document — for example, an annual report PDF linked from a search_filings result. Best combined with search_filings: use search_filings to locate the document, then parse_pdf_to_text for the full text. Do not use for PDFs that are already well-represented in the database — search_filings is faster and returns pre-ranked, relevant excerpts. Not suitable for scanned (image-only) PDFs without embedded text; those pages will be returned as "(no extractable text)". Args: pdf_url: Direct HTTPS URL to the PDF file, e.g. https://example.com/report.pdf. Must be publicly accessible; authentication-protected URLs will fail. Returns: All text from the PDF with "--- Page N ---" separators between pages. Returns an error string if the download fails, the URL does not point to a valid PDF, or the document exceeds the 60-second download timeout.
